Overview This page contains the latest trade data of Mobile drilling derricks. In 2022, Mobile drilling derricks were the world's 3814th most traded product, with a total trade of $175M. Between 2021 and 2022 the exports of Mobile drilling derricks grew by 0.72%, from $174M to $175M. Trade in Mobile drilling derricks represent 0.00074% of total world trade.

Mobile drilling derricks are a part of Special purpose motor vehicles.

Exports In 2022 the top exporters of Mobile drilling derricks  were United States ($30.2M), Canada ($29.9M), Germany ($18.2M), United Arab Emirates ($14.7M), and India ($11.1M).

Imports In 2022 the top importers of Mobile drilling derricks were Canada ($18.7M), United States ($17.7M), United Arab Emirates ($16.9M), Australia ($8.51M), and Saudi Arabia ($7.97M).

Ranking Mobile drilling derricks ranks 4233rd in the Product Complexity Index (PCI).

Description A mobile drilling derrick is a tower on wheels that can be erected at a drilling site. These towers are used to drill oil and gas wells.

Between 2021 and 2022, the exports of Mobile drilling derricks grew the fastest in Canada ($17.2M), United Arab Emirates ($8.23M), Germany ($6.05M), Austria ($6M), and United States ($4.17M).

Between 2021 and 2022, the fastest growing importers of Mobile drilling derricks were United States ($7.89M), Australia ($6.42M), Canada ($5.89M), Saudi Arabia ($5.23M), and United Arab Emirates ($4.31M).

This chart shows the evolution of the market concentration of exports of Mobile drilling derricks.

In 2022, market concentration measured using Shannon Entropy, was 4.07. This means that most of the exports of Mobile drilling derricks are explained by 16 countries.

This map shows which countries export or import more of Mobile drilling derricks. Each country is colored based on the difference in exports and imports of Mobile drilling derricks during 2022.

In 2022, the countries that had a largest trade value in exports than in imports of Mobile drilling derricks were Germany ($18M), United States ($12.5M), Canada ($11.2M), China ($11.1M), and India ($10.8M).

In 2022, the countries that had a largest trade value in imports than in exports of Mobile drilling derricks were Zimbabwe ($4.59M), Romania ($4.52M), Australia ($4.29M), Kazakhstan ($3.96M), and Spain ($3.85M).
